      Lovely overview of the topic: and you're right, there has never been any convincing evidence that endogenous DMT plays any role in consciousness, let alone whether or not it exists in humans.

      On a related note, here's a recent study that looked at the psychological benefits of mystical experiences that occur both naturally and due to taking psychedelic drugs:

      https://journals.plos.org/plosone/ar...l.pone.0214377

      Although there were some other differences between non-drug and the combined psychedelic group, as well as between the four psychedelic groups, the similarities among these groups were most striking. Most participants reported vivid memories of the encounter experience, which frequently involved communication with something having the attributes of being conscious, benevolent, intelligent, sacred, eternal, and all-knowing. The encounter experience fulfilled a priori criteria for being a complete mystical experience in approximately half of the participants. More than two-thirds of those who identified as atheist before the experience no longer identified as atheist afterwards. These experiences were rated as among the most personally meaningful and spiritually significant lifetime experiences, with moderate to strong persisting positive changes in life satisfaction, purpose, and meaning attributed to these experiences.

      Erowid has lots of good information on DMT:

      https://erowid.org/chemicals/dmt/

      What they say about DMT and the pineal gland is worth reading:

      https://erowid.org/chemicals/dmt/dmt_article2.shtml

      It references this journal article:

      https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pubmed/29095071

      Abstract

      The pineal gland has a romantic history, from pharaonic Egypt, where it was equated with the eye of Horus, through various religious traditions, where it was considered the seat of the soul, the third eye, etc. Recent incarnations of these notions have suggested that N,N-dimethyltryptamine is secreted by the pineal gland at birth, during dreaming, and at near death to produce out of body experiences. Scientific evidence, however, is not consistent with these ideas. The adult pineal gland weighs less than 0.2 g, and its principal function is to produce about 30 µg per day of melatonin, a hormone that regulates circadian rhythm through very high affinity interactions with melatonin receptors. It is clear that very minute concentrations of N,N-dimethyltryptamine have been detected in the brain, but they are not sufficient to produce psychoactive effects. Alternative explanations are presented to explain how stress and near death can produce altered states of consciousness without invoking the intermediacy of N,N-dimethyltryptamine.
